Sun Property Holdings is two-thirds owned by hospitality group Red Rock Leisure, which operates the P.J OâBrienâs chain of Irish-themed pubs and Jon Hasler, a director of Red Rock Leisure.
John Musca from JLL Hotels negotiated the off-market sale of Cheeky Monkeyâs and the Thai Sabai tenancy.
The property, which occupies an 827sq m site with 2am trading approval, sold as vacant premises.
Mr Musca said it was fitting that Merivale was bringing its well-known brand to Byron Bay at a time of its âexciting development evolutionâ.
JLL has sold around $90 million of hospitality assets to the Merivale Group over the past 10 weeks including the Lorne Hotel and Nortonâs Irish Hotel.
